Time Crisis 2 is a rail shooter developed and published by Namco, released in arcades in 1997 and later ported to the PlayStation in 1998. It is the sequel to the original Time Crisis and significantly expands the formula with two-player cooperative gameplay, improved graphics, and more dynamic action.

What is Time Crisis 2?

Time Crisis 2 follows elite agents Keith Martin and Robert Baxter as they work together to stop a global threat involving stolen nuclear satellites. The game builds on the original’s cover-based shooting system while adding more cinematic pacing and multiplayer depth.

Gameplay Overview

Light Gun Rail Shooter

Players aim and shoot enemies using a light gun (or controller on PlayStation). Movement is automatic along fixed paths, allowing full focus on reaction speed and accuracy.

Enhanced Cover System

The signature pedal mechanic returns and is refined:

  • Press pedal to expose and shoot
  • Release pedal to take cover and reload
  • Time cover use to avoid heavy fire

Two-Player Co-op

The biggest upgrade over the original game is full cooperative play. Two players can play simultaneously, coordinating shots and covering each other during intense firefights.

Story Overview

The story follows agents Keith Martin and Robert Baxter as they investigate a terrorist organization that has stolen nuclear satellites. Their mission takes them across multiple global locations, each filled with armed enemies, helicopters, and explosive set pieces.

Graphics and Sound

Time Crisis 2 uses upgraded 3D environments and smoother animations compared to its predecessor. Explosions, enemy animations, and cinematic camera angles make the action feel more dynamic and modern for its era.

The soundtrack is fast-paced and cinematic, reinforcing the urgency of each mission and increasing tension during boss fights.

Legacy

Time Crisis 2 is considered one of the greatest light gun shooters of all time. Its co-op gameplay, improved visuals, and refined mechanics helped define the golden era of arcade shooting games and cemented Namco’s reputation in the genre.
